news 2026/4/20 7:37:52

Cyber Engine Tweaks快捷键系统深度解析:5个步骤实现完全自定义控制

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
Cyber Engine Tweaks快捷键系统深度解析:5个步骤实现完全自定义控制

Cyber Engine Tweaks快捷键系统深度解析:5个步骤实现完全自定义控制

【免费下载链接】CyberEngineTweaksCyberpunk 2077 tweaks, hacks and scripting framework项目地址: https://gitcode.com/gh_mirrors/cy/CyberEngineTweaks

Cyber Engine Tweaks(CET)作为《赛博朋克2077》最强大的模组框架,其快捷键控制系统为用户提供了前所未有的操作自由度。通过精心设计的输入处理机制和灵活的绑定配置,玩家能够彻底重塑游戏交互体验。🎮

系统核心架构与技术实现原理

CET快捷键系统采用分层架构设计,主要由输入管理层、绑定处理器和用户界面三大模块构成。这种设计确保了系统的高效运行和扩展性。

输入管理层 - VKBindings模块

VKBindings.h 是整个系统的调度中心,负责管理所有快捷键的生命周期。该模块采用基于消息的输入处理机制,通过Windows原始输入API捕获所有键盘和鼠标事件。

关键技术特性包括:

  • 多键组合支持:最多支持4个按键的复杂组合绑定
  • 实时状态跟踪:通过位集数据结构维护256个按键的实时状态
  • 异步回调队列:确保输入处理不会阻塞游戏主线程

绑定处理器 - 动态执行引擎

绑定处理器采用双模式设计,支持热键和输入两种不同类型的快捷键:

热键模式特点:

  • 需要完整的按键序列(按下并释放)
  • 适合触发一次性功能命令
  • 支持复杂条件判断

输入模式特点:

  • 响应单个按键的按下和释放事件
  • 适合需要持续状态的功能
  • 实时响应无延迟

用户界面层 - Bindings组件

Bindings.h 提供了直观的图形配置界面,采用ImGui技术实现原生游戏风格的UI体验。

实战配置:5步完成高级快捷键设置

第一步:系统初始化与模块识别

首次启动CET时,系统会自动检测已安装的模组并建立绑定注册表。每个模组通过唯一的命名空间标识符来管理自己的快捷键配置。

第二步:快捷键类型选择策略

根据功能需求选择合适的快捷键类型:

  • 游戏内功能切换:推荐使用热键模式
  • 实时状态控制:推荐使用输入模式
  • 复杂操作序列:使用多键组合热键

第三步:绑定录制与冲突检测

CET提供智能绑定录制功能:

  1. 启动录制模式
  2. 按下目标按键组合
  3. 系统自动检测并提示冲突
  4. 确认保存配置

第四步:多模组绑定协调管理

当多个模组同时运行时,CET的绑定协调器会:

  • 自动解决命名空间冲突
  • 提供绑定优先级管理
  • 支持模组间绑定共享

第五步:性能优化与配置持久化

通过合理的配置策略提升系统性能:

  • 避免过度复杂的嵌套绑定
  • 定期清理无效配置
  • 利用配置缓存加速启动

高级应用:专业级快捷键配置方案

游戏性能监控快捷键组

为性能监控工具配置专用快捷键:

  • FPS显示切换:Ctrl+Shift+F
  • 内存使用监控:Ctrl+Shift+M
  • CPU负载查看:Ctrl+Shift+C

模组功能快速访问方案

为常用模组功能设置快捷访问:

  • 物品生成器:Alt+F1
  • 角色编辑器:Alt+F2
  • 任务管理器:Alt+F3

自定义界面布局控制

通过快捷键实现界面元素的动态控制:

  • 覆盖层位置调整
  • 窗口大小切换
  • 主题模式轮换

故障诊断:常见问题与解决方案

快捷键失效排查流程

  1. 检查绑定状态:确认快捷键已正确配置
  2. 验证模组兼容性:确保无模组间冲突
  3. 检查输入优先级:验证系统输入处理顺序

配置丢失恢复策略

CET提供多重配置保护机制:

  • 自动备份最新配置
  • 版本兼容性检查
  • 手动恢复选项

性能问题优化方案

针对快捷键响应延迟问题:

  • 简化复杂绑定组合
  • 减少同时激活的绑定数量
  • 优化回调函数执行效率

最佳实践:高效快捷键管理指南

命名规范与组织策略

采用统一的命名约定:

  • 模组前缀标识
  • 功能描述后缀
  • 版本号标记

配置备份与迁移方案

确保个性化配置的安全:

  • 定期导出绑定配置
  • 跨版本升级前备份
  • 多设备间配置同步

性能调优:系统响应速度提升技巧

绑定处理优化策略

通过技术手段提升快捷键响应速度:

  • 使用高效的算法实现
  • 优化数据结构访问模式
  • 减少不必要的系统调用

内存使用控制方案

CET快捷键系统经过精心设计,内存占用极小。通过以下方式进一步优化:

  • 及时清理无效绑定
  • 压缩配置存储空间
  • 使用内存池管理资源

未来展望:系统扩展与生态发展

随着《赛博朋克2077》模组生态的不断发展,CET快捷键系统将持续演进:

技术发展方向:

  • 支持更多输入设备类型
  • 增强绑定条件判断能力
  • 提供更智能的冲突解决方案

用户体验提升:

  • 更直观的配置界面
  • 更强大的调试工具
  • 更完善的技术文档

Cyber Engine Tweaks的快捷键控制系统为玩家提供了深度定制游戏体验的技术基础。通过掌握这些高级配置技巧,用户能够充分发挥系统的潜力,打造完全个性化的游戏操作环境。💻

无论你是技术爱好者还是普通玩家,这套系统都能让你在夜之城的冒险中更加得心应手。通过合理配置和优化,快捷键系统将成为提升游戏体验的强大工具。

【免费下载链接】CyberEngineTweaksCyberpunk 2077 tweaks, hacks and scripting framework项目地址: https://gitcode.com/gh_mirrors/cy/CyberEngineTweaks

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/17 23:58:29

HTML5-QRCode 跨平台二维码扫描完全指南

HTML5-QRCode 跨平台二维码扫描完全指南 【免费下载链接】html5-qrcode A cross platform HTML5 QR code reader. See end to end implementation at: https://scanapp.org 项目地址: https://gitcode.com/gh_mirrors/ht/html5-qrcode HTML5-QRCode 是一个功能强大的跨平…

作者头像 李华
网站建设 2026/4/17 14:26:19

weibo-rss:让你的微博订阅体验焕然一新

weibo-rss:让你的微博订阅体验焕然一新 【免费下载链接】weibo-rss 🍰 把某人最近的微博转为 RSS 订阅源 项目地址: https://gitcode.com/gh_mirrors/we/weibo-rss 你是否曾经为了不错过心仪博主的更新,不得不频繁刷新微博页面&#x…

作者头像 李华
网站建设 2026/4/20 10:35:51

如何使用ACS712电流传感器:Arduino完整配置指南

ACS712电流传感器是一款专为Arduino平台设计的硬件库,能够精确测量5A、20A和30A范围内的交流或直流电流。这款传感器通过输出提供与电流成线性关系的电压信号,是电子爱好者和工程师进行电流监测的理想选择。 【免费下载链接】ACS712 Arduino library for…

作者头像 李华
网站建设 2026/4/20 12:37:51

Starward游戏启动器:彻底改变你的米哈游游戏体验

Starward游戏启动器:彻底改变你的米哈游游戏体验 【免费下载链接】Starward Game Launcher for miHoYo - 米家游戏启动器 项目地址: https://gitcode.com/gh_mirrors/st/Starward 还在为频繁切换不同游戏账号而烦恼吗?Starward游戏启动器将为你带…

作者头像 李华
网站建设 2026/4/17 23:05:57

超强视频下载助手:一键保存网页视频的完整指南

超强视频下载助手:一键保存网页视频的完整指南 【免费下载链接】VideoDownloadHelper Chrome Extension to Help Download Video for Some Video Sites. 项目地址: https://gitcode.com/gh_mirrors/vi/VideoDownloadHelper 🎬 还在为无法下载网页…

作者头像 李华
网站建设 2026/4/16 14:17:25

SetDPI:Windows多显示器DPI缩放终极解决方案

SetDPI:Windows多显示器DPI缩放终极解决方案 【免费下载链接】SetDPI 项目地址: https://gitcode.com/gh_mirrors/se/SetDPI 在日常办公环境中,连接多个显示器已成为提高工作效率的常见做法。然而,Windows系统在多显示器环境下的DPI缩…

作者头像 李华